Jade loses hair
DEVASTATED Jade Goody has lost all her hair after chemotherapy in her cancer fight.

The mum of two, 27, was in tears when most of it fell out over the weekend.

The Big Brother star is now covering her head with a scarf.

A pal said: “It’s a tough time. Jade knew it would happen but nothing really prepares you.

“Her hair had started to thin, but all of a sudden it just came out and gave her a real shock. She feels very unwell due to the treatment and is generally low.”

Jade had a hysterectomy last September after she was found to have had cervical cancer — but medics discovered it had spread. She had a chemo session at London’s Royal Marsden Hospital yesterday and faces a blood transfusion today.

Speaking about the prospect of going bald, Jade had tearfully told how sons Bobby, five, and Freddie, four, said to her: “We will still love you, Mummy.”

She was recently in hospital for an emergency op to repair a blocked kidney — which meant she had to quit her Wicked Witch panto role in Snow White at Lincoln. Jade has also been unable to shake off flu after her white blood cell count fell dangerously low following chemo.

But she plans to keep working to provide for her sons. She said: “I hate letting people down but I have to be careful not to get too ill as my immune system is so low.”
